Bahasa Indonesia Français Tiếng Việt فارسی Deutsch Italiano Türkçe ภาษาไทย English Polski Русский 日本語 Español Português (Brasil) العربية

Convert PDF to BMP in C#

Wordize for .NET converts PDF pages to BMP images with high-quality rendering. The Converter class transforms PDF documents to BMP format while preserving all visual elements.

Module Requirements:
  • Core for .NET - base module for conversion operations
  • PDF Load for .NET - for reading PDF documents
  • Rendering for .NET - for BMP format export

.NET API Features for PDF to BMP Conversion

  • ConvertToImages() method for PDF to BMP transformation
  • Configure BMP image resolution and quality
  • Batch convert all PDF pages
  • Optimize BMP file size for web usage
  • Merge pages into a single BMP image

Common PDF to BMP Conversion Scenarios

  • Document management systems: create BMP previews of PDF files for quick viewing
  • Mobile adaptation: convert PDF to BMP for comfortable viewing on mobile devices
  • Marketing materials: export PDF slides as BMP for presentations
  • Web galleries: create BMP galleries from PDF catalogs and brochures
  • Corporate portals: display PDF documents as BMP images on websites

Test PDF to BMP conversion using our interactive online demo. Upload your PDF file, run the conversion, and download high-quality BMP images. The provided C# code is ready for integration into your .NET project.

Run code
Test Wordize SDK - upload a document and explore code examples
  • PNG
  • BMP
  • EMF
  • GIF
  • SVG
  • TIFF
  • JPG
Select output format from the list
using Wordize.Conversion;
using Wordize.Saving;

var imageStreams = Converter.ConvertToImages("Input.pdf", new ImageSaveOptions(SaveFormat.Bmp));

foreach (var (stream, page) in imageStreams.Select((s, i) => (s, i)))
{
    using var _ = stream;
    stream.Position = 0;

    using var file = File.Create($"Output_{page + 1}.bmp");
    stream.CopyTo(file);
}
using Wordize.Conversion; Converter.Convert("{{input1}}", "{{output}}"); using Wordize.Conversion; using Wordize.Saving; var imageStreams = Converter.ConvertToImages("{{input1}}", new ImageSaveOptions(SaveFormat.{{saveFormat}})); foreach (var (stream, page) in imageStreams.Select((s, i) => (s, i))) { using var _ = stream; stream.Position = 0; using var file = File.Create($"Output_{page + 1}.{{outputExt}}"); stream.CopyTo(file); } using Wordize.Conversion; using Wordize.Saving; ImageSaveOptions saveOptions = new ImageSaveOptions(SaveFormat.{{saveFormat}}); saveOptions.PageLayout = MultiPageLayout.Vertical(10); Converter.Create() .From("{{input1}}") .To("{{output}}", saveOptions) .Execute();
Run code

How to Convert PDF to BMP in C#

  1. 1
    Add Wordize for .NET to your project

    Add Wordize SDK to your .NET project

  2. 2
    Convert PDF to BMP programmatically in C#

    Call the Converter.Convert() method, specifying input and output file names as parameters. Formats are automatically detected based on file extensions

  3. 3
    Get conversion result

    Get the BMP file

5%